About for Startups

Company profile

Company name


for Startups, Inc.

Location of head office

36F, Izumi Garden Tower, 1-6-1 Roppongi, Minato-ku, Tokyo 106-6036

Capital

226million yen(as of June 30, 2022)

Established

September 1, 2016

Representative

Yuichiro Shimizu, President

Number of regular employees

187 (as of April 1st, 2023)

Nature of business

Growth industry support services

License

Employment placement business license 13-Yu-307946

Additional information

Member of the Japan Business Federation (Keidanren)
Member of the Japan Association of New Economy (Shinkeiren)
CVC member of the Japan Venture Capital Association (JVCA)
Selected as a supporter company of J-Startup by the Ministry of Economy, Trade and Industry

Board Members

Yuichiro Shimizu

PRESIDENT AND CEO
After launching the career change service "Doda" at Intelligence, Ltd. (currently Persol Career Co., Ltd.), in 2016 he established NET jinzai bank, Inc. (currently for Startups, Inc.) to engage in support services for growth industries, and became its president and CEO. Also in 2016, in the Japan Headhunter Awards, he was named Japan's first Hall of Fame headhunter. He has served since 2019 on the venture ecosystem committee of the Japan Venture Capital Association, and in 2020, he was appointed to a task force on startup policy under Keidanren's Sub-committee on Startups.

Yukiko Tsuneda

MANAGING DIRECTOR; HEAD OF TALENT AGENCY DIVISION
She worked at Sammy Networks Co., Ltd. and then joined Metaps Inc., becoming the business manager of that company. She joined NET jinzai bank, Inc. (currently for Startups, Inc.) in October 2016, and took on the management of the Talent Agency Division after becoming an executive officer in April 2018. She became a director in 2019. In 2020, she became a member of the Japan Association of Corporate Executives (Keizai Doyukai). She was appointed Managing Director in 2021. She received the Creation category award in the 17th Globis Alumni Awards.

Isao Kikuchi

DIRECTOR; HEAD OF CORPORATE DIVISION
At Deloitte Touche Tohmatsu LLC, he did statutory audit work for domestic and global companies and was involved in advisory services to support measures such as the development of internal controls and introduction of the International Financial Reporting Standards (IFRS). In 2018, he joined for Startups, Inc. as a corporate auditor. He then took on the management of the Corporate Division, with responsibility for all back office operations. He became a director in 2019. He is a certified public accountant.

Kazuhiko Shimizu

DIRECTOR; HEAD OF ACCELERATION DIVISION
He worked at Glorious Co., Ltd. and RSS Kokokusha (currently Fringe81 Co., Ltd.), and then participated in the launch of NET jinzai bank at Saint Media, Inc. (currently Willof Work, Inc.). He has continued to gain experience in the human resources business, and after becoming an executive officer in 2018, he took charge of human resources as CHRO. He became a director and head of the Human Resources Division in June 2019, and he became the head of the Acceleration Division in July 2019. In May 2021, he became a representative of for Startups Capital Inc.

History

4/2013

Founding of the NET jinzai bank division of Saint Media, Inc. (currently Willof Work, Inc.), a subsidiary of the Will Group

9/2016

Establishment of NET jinzai bank, Inc. (a wholly owned subsidiary of the Will Group) in a company split

3/2018

Company name changed to for Startups, Inc.

4/2018

Became a member of the Japan Venture Capital Association

5/2018

Release of Startup DB, an information platform specialized in the area of growth industries

4/2019

Launch of the Open Innovation service

7/2019 

Began a business alliance with Crunchbase, Inc. (U.S.)

3/2020

Listed on the Tokyo Stock Exchange, Mothers Index (stock code: 7089)

6/2020

Became a member of the Japan Business Federation (Keidanren)

8/2020

Business alliance with SMBC Group

1/2021

Became a member of the Japan Association of New Economy (Shinkeiren)

5/2021

Establishment of for Startups Capital Inc., a subsidiary that engages in investment
